Title: The Innovative Mind of Etsuya Ohishi
Introduction: Etsuya Ohishi, a distinguished inventor based in Toyota, Japan, has made significant contributions to the automotive industry through his innovative designs and patents. With a total of 10 patents to his name, Ohishi exemplifies the spirit of creativity and innovation that drives the field of engineering forward.
Latest Patents: Among Etsuya Ohishi's latest inventions is a patented "Motor vehicle and/or toy replica thereof," which showcases his ability to merge functionality with creativity. This patent underscores his focus on automotive advancements, particularly how his work at Toyota Motor Corporation influences the development of both full-scale vehicles and their smaller counterparts.
Career Highlights: Ohishi has built an impressive career at Toyota Motor Corporation (Toyota Jidosha Kabushiki Kaisha), where he has dedicated his efforts to enhancing vehicle design and technology. His work has directly contributed to Toyota's reputation as a leader in the automotive sector, particularly in innovation and efficiency.
Collaborations: Throughout his career, Etsuya Ohishi has collaborated with notable colleagues, including Michio Tada and Nobuyuki Tomatsu. These collaborations have fostered a creative environment where ideas flourish, leading to groundbreaking developments in automotive engineering.
